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en Seaport
¿Que tipo de alquileres hay actualmente en Seaport?
Actualmente hay 3039 Apartamentos de Alquiler en Seaport, MA con precios que van desde $868 hasta $27,123. También hay 2007 Casas Unifamiliares, Condominios y Casas Adosadas en alquiler disponibles actualmente en Seaport que van desde $1,060 hasta $45,000.
¿Cuál es el rango de precios actual de las viviendas de alquiler en Seaport?
Los precios hoy en día para las casas,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ler en Seaport oscilan entre $1,060 hasta $45,000 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$4,698.
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en Seaport?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Seaport oscilan entre $1,100 hasta $27,123,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$1,060 hasta $45,000.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$1,080 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$870.
